PASHA Member CyberSilo Expands To Eight Countries Across GCC And Asia In Global Growth Push

Pakistani cybersecurity firm CyberSilo has achieved a significant international milestone, expanding its operations across eight countries including key markets in the Gulf Cooperation Council region and Asia as of January 31, 2026. The achievement was spotlighted by PASHA (Pakistan IT Industry Association) as part of its ongoing effort to highlight the growing global footprint of Pakistan’s technology sector under the Tech Destination Pakistan narrative.

CyberSilo, which describes its mission as building trust in a digital world through innovative cybersecurity solutions that protect and empower organisations of all sizes, brings over 30 years of collective excellence to its operations, having protected more than 500 clients through eight distinct security solutions. The company’s expansion into eight countries represents a meaningful leap in its international presence, with the GCC and Asian markets offering substantial demand for enterprise-grade cybersecurity services as digital transformation accelerates across both regions. During the expansion milestone, the company launched its product, conducted partner training, completed trials, and onboarded customers with measurable success, establishing the foundation from which it now plans to enter additional countries to further scale its global presence.

PASHA noted that the CyberSilo milestone reflects the company’s ability to scale across diverse markets while demonstrating how Pakistani technology solutions are making a tangible international impact. The recognition comes as Pakistan’s cybersecurity sector continues to grow in both capability and ambition, with firms like CyberSilo increasingly competing for enterprise contracts in markets that have historically been dominated by Western and regional players. PASHA has invited other member companies to share their achievements for similar recognition, reinforcing the association’s commitment to amplifying the success stories emerging from Pakistan’s expanding technology industry on the world stage.

CWPK Legacy
Launched in 1967 internationally, ComputerWorld is the oldest tech magazine/media property in the world. In Pakistan, ComputerWorld was launched in 1995. Initially providing news to IT executives only, once CIO Pakistan, its sister brand from the same family, was launched and took over the enterprise reporting domain in Pakistan, CWPK has emerged as a holistic technology media platform reporting everything tech in the country. It remains the oldest continuous IT publishing brand in the country and in 2025 is set to turn 30 years old, which will be its biggest benchmark and a legacy it hopes to continue for years to come. CWPK is part of the SPIN/IDG Wakhan media umbrella.
